Question # 2: Odds Ratio and Relative Risk (20 points) A researcher would like to assess the relationship between an exercise program (Program A) that can prevent obesity among youth and a newer more rigorous program (Program B) that was developed by a group of middle school coaches. The students are assessed at the end of the school year. After addressing all ethical considerations and adjusting for potential confounders, the following results are obtained. Student BMI at the End of the School Year Overweight/ Obese Not Overweight/ Obese Program A 42 58 100 Program B 31 69 100 73 127 200
